Central Japan

Chubu is a big region in the center of Japan with big cities such as Nagoya, the key economic center of the area, and Nagano, known if its natural beauty. The region also has a lot of mountains with Mount Fuji being the most famous.

A lot of different tracks can be found in the Chubu region:
Fuji Speedway
Motorland Mikawa
ALT Tsukude
Spa Nishiura Motor Park
Kyosei Driver Land
Mihama Circuit
Sports Land Yamanashi
Nihonkai Maze Circuit
Owara Circuit
Takasu Circuit
YZ Circuit